Safe Homes Of Augusta Inc

Organization Overview

Safe Homes Of Augusta Inc is located in Augusta, GA. The organization was established in 1987. According to its NTEE Classification (P43) the organization is classified as: Family Violence Shelters, under the broad grouping of Human Services and related organizations. As of 09/2023, Safe Homes Of Augusta Inc employed 38 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Safe Homes Of Augusta Inc is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 09/2023, Safe Homes Of Augusta Inc generated $2.0m in total revenue. This represents relatively stable growth, over the past 8 years the organization has increased revenue by an average of 4.8% each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$1.9m during the year ending 09/2023. While expenses have increased by 5.5% per year over the past 8 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

TO PROVIDE ASSISTANCE FROM DOMESTIC VIOLENCE.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

A PROGRAM OF DIRECTED AND FOCUSED SERVICES FOR WOMEN, MEN, AND CHILDREN, THE CENTER CAN SHELTER UP TO 24 INDIVIDUALS AT ONE TIME IN THE EMERGENCY SHELTER AND ALSO OFFERS ESSENTIAL AID TO NON-RESIDENTIAL VICTIMS OF VIOLENCE THROUGH OUTREACH.
